Student Organizations
 

Boston University offers more than 400 student groups on campus, from cultural and religious organizations to political activism groups to vocal, dance, theatre, and comedy performance groups. No matter what your background or interests, you can find your niche at Boston University—and if you can’t, all it takes to start a group of your own is five members.

College of Arts and Sciences Student Groups: There are several organizations and academic societies specifically for students in the College of Arts and Sciences. These include major-specific groups, student representation on faculty committees, and academic honor societies.
